2002 SPRINTER 2500

1 recall campaign on file for this model year. No owner complaints in our copy of the federal file.

Recalls

Recall campaignNHTSA 04V600000

Tires: valve

Component
Tires: valve
Manufacturer
DAIMLERCHRYSLER MANUFACTURING INTL
Vehicles affected
23,000
Reported to NHTSA
2004-12-23
Owners notified
2005-04-04

Defect description

ON CERTAIN TRUCKS DISTRIBUTED BY DODGE OR FREIGHTLINER AND EQUIPPED WITH A TIRE VALVE, TR600, ON 16" TIRES, THE VALVE CAN DEVELOP CRACKS WITHIN THE RUBBER PART OR BETWEEN THE METAL PART AND THE RUBBER PART OF THE VALVE STEM.

Safety risk

SUCH CRACKING MAY LEAD TO A LOSS OF AIR PRESSURE AT THE VALVE STEM, INCREASING THE RISK OF A CRASH.

Manufacturer remedy

DEALERS WILL REPLACE THE TIRE VALVES ON ALL SPRINTER VEHICLES. THE RECALL BEGAN ON APRIL 4, 2005. OWNERS SHOULD CONTACT DAIMLERCHRYSLER AT 1-800-853-1403.
